Lightroom, Bridge, Photoshop version compatibility

I am now using Lightroom 1.1 and also have Photoshop CS2 (version 9.0.2), Bridge CS2 and of course Camera Raw (version ?)installed on my Windows XP computer. My question is, do I have to upgrade to Photoshop CS3 and Camera Raw 4 for compatibility with Lightroom? Also, how do I know which version of Camera Raw is installed?
PB

Lightroom has its own version of Camera RAW. The only reason you'd need to upgrade to CS3 is to get the latest version of Camera RAW, and the only reason you'd need to do that is if you want to be able to open the images you edit in Lightroom in Camera RAW and still have all the edits in place. You can open the image itself (processed through Lightroom) in Photoshop will all the edits in place regardless of what version you are using (I use Elements 3.0).

  • Photoshop Extended version compatability

    I have Photoshop CS3 Extended on both PC (Windows XP) and Mac (OS X Leopard). I'm able to upgrade the PC to CS5 Extended but not the Mac.
    My questions are:
    1 - Will Photoshop CS5 extended work on Windows XP?
    2 - Are CS3 and CS5 backwards compatible - if I work on a document in PC CS5 will the Mac CS5 version be able to open it? I know there will be some things that would not translate backwards, such as Puppet Warp and some of the newer masking and layers features, but I'd still like to be able to work on more basic functions of masking, cloning, etc. on both computers.
    Thanks for any help,
    Marcy

    Noel Car boni wrote:
    For the most part, a document saved from Photoshop CS5 will be no problem to open in CS3.  There's a "Maximize Compatibility" setting in Edit - Preferences - File Handling section that you'll want to set to "Always".
    -Noel
    My take is that the compatibility setting should be set based on the kind of work one does.  I have it set to  "Never".  When you check this setting ON you tell Photoshop to save along with all your layers another entity, which is a flattened version of the image. This, makes every PSD file you save larger by a non trival amount.
    So this setting should have no effect regarding Photoshop to Photoshop version compatibility. All Photoshop versions understand layers and do not need a flattened version.  It's intended to maximize the compatibility between Photoshop and any other program  that does not know about  layers but reads PSD files. If you have many of your PSD files going to, for example,  Lightroom or Premiere then set it to "Always". If not, you can set it to "Ask" or "Never" and save yourself a lot of storage space.

  • After installation of latest Bridge and Photoshop version (2014.2.2) *.CR2 files will not be displayed correctly, neither in preview nor in Camera Raw dialog.

    After installation of latest Bridge and Photoshop version (2014.2.2) *.CR2 files will not be displayed correctly anymore, neither in preview nor in Camera Raw dialogue.
    Some pictures have white squares with blue and red diagonal stripes that cover almost the complete picture.
    When opening those files I have the same problem in Camera Raw dailogue and even in Photoshop eventually.
    I tried to open the same same pictures on another computer with the same version of Bridge and Photoshop but the problem remains the same.
    It seems like the files itselves are still ok, because if you open an explorer window the previews of the pictures are all ok. And the pictures' sizes remain the same.
    I tried to clear the cache in both programs but it didn't help.
    Has anyone an idea????

    First see if a reboot of your PC helps.  If not,
    Resets may be in order:
    Photoshop: Press and hold Control - Shift - Alt immediately upon cold-starting Photoshop.  If you get the keys down quickly enough - and you have to be VERY quick - it will prompt you to confirm deletion of your established preferences, which will lead to them all being set to defaults.
    Bridge:  Start Adobe Bridge and immediately press Ctrl+Alt+Shift (Windows) or Command+Option+Shift (Mac OS) until the Reset Settings dialog box appears. Select all three options--Reset Preferences, Reset Standard Workspaces, and Purge Entire Thumbnail Cache--and then click OK.
    Outdated graphics drivers can also cause display problems. Go to your GPU maker's website and be sure you have the latest drivers for your card model.

  • Upgraded to Creative Cloud from elements 9 where images are stored in Organizer.  How do I bring them into Creative Cloud and should I download them to Lightroom, Bridge, or Photoshop itself?  Any suggestions?

    Just upgraded to Creative Cloud from elements 9 where images are stored in Organizer.  How do I bring them into Creative Cloud and should I download them to Lightroom, Bridge, or Photoshop itself?  Any suggestions?

    lawrencer72634146 a écrit:
    Just upgraded to Creative Cloud from elements 9 where images are stored in Organizer.  How do I bring them into Creative Cloud and should I download them to Lightroom, Bridge, or Photoshop itself?  Any suggestions?
    It's important to keep in mind that the picture files are NOT stored in the Organizer. They are not stored in Lightroom or Bridge either...
    The organizer is based on a catalog which stores the pictures properties, mainly the location of the pictures on your drive(s). It's the same idea of catalogs in Lightroom, and the nice thing is that Lightroom can convert organizer catalogs to its own format. The most obvious way for you will be to use Lightroom.
    Bridge is a file browser which is a different way than to use catalogs.

  • Looking to purchase Nik software for Lightroom OR Photoshop. Is there a difference in the versions?

    I currently use photoshop for all of my photo editing. I just purchased a copy of Lightroom though, which I plan on integrating into my workflow. I'm also looking to buy the complete collection of Nik software. If I want it to be compatible with photoshop, the complete collection is $200 more expensive. My question is are the versions of Nik software the exact same whether using it for Lightroom or Photoshop? What potential drawbacks are there for me not to be able to use Nik in photoshop, but only in lightroom?
    Thanks!

    The versions are similar but the photoshop version gives you the extra tools for, brushing, erase, fill and clear which to be honest i've never felt a great use for and if you duplicate the layer in photoshop before heading back to LR (to use NIK) you essentially get the same thing.  Eg:
    LR to photoshop as TIF or PSD
    Duplicate layer
    Save and back to Lightroom
    Add NIK effect
    Back to photoshop if you want to do any brushing or mask erasing of the nik plugin you applied in LR because you have the original layer underneith.
    Even better if you think you can get away with all your editing in LR because you will always have the adjusted RAW alongside the TIF or PSD that Nik software will create anyway.  I say save your money, a whole $250 now because the Lightroom version has been reduced again.
